"Beiguan" meaning in English

See Beiguan in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

Etymology: From the Hanyu Pinyin romanization of the Mandarin 北關/北关 (Běiguān). Etymology templates: {{bor|en|cmn-pinyin|-}} Hanyu Pinyin, {{bor|en|cmn|北關}} Mandarin 北關/北关 (Běiguān) Head templates: {{en-proper noun}} Beiguan
  1. A district of Anyang, Henan, China. Wikipedia link: Beiguan Categories (place): Places in China, Places in Henan Translations (district): 北關 (Chinese Mandarin), 北关 (Běiguān) (Chinese Mandarin)
